What to eat on the low carb diet?

In general, to have good results with the low carb diet, in addition to ingesting the correct amounts of nutrients, you need to choose natural foods. Below are some tips on what you should consume during this weight loss process:

Most recommended foods

1. Greens and vegetables

Give preference to low-carb vegetables, such as zucchini, broccoli, cauliflower, chard, mushrooms, celery, cherry tomatoes, peppers, kale, watercress, asparagus, eggplant, spinach, cucumber, arugula and so on.

Pumpkin and sweet potatoes, for example, are usually included in the diet, but need to be consumed in moderation due to the large amount of carbohydrates they contain.

2. Fruits

Once again, some types of fruit are more beneficial than others due to their carbohydrate concentration. Bananas, papaya and fruits rich in fructose, for example, need to be consumed in moderation and, preferably, together with a source of fiber, such as chia, flaxseed and other types of oilseeds. In some cases, the pomace itself, like that of gossip, helps to reduce the speed at which the body will digest the carbohydrates present in the fruits.

On the other hand, avocado, strawberries, peach, melon and coconut are some of the fruits considered low carb.

3. Proteins

Meat, fish, eggs, milk and derivatives, soy and quinoa, for example, are considered great sources of protein in the low carb diet and help provide amino acids to the body, contribute to structural, motor, metabolic functions, collagen production, in the construction of muscle fibers, hormones, enzymes and even in the regulation of the body’s immunological functions.

But, in addition to moderate and personalized consumption according to each person’s needs, it is necessary to give preference to leaner proteins, such as skimmed milk, white cheeses, fish, chicken and, in the case of beef, for cuts such as duckling, fillet mignon and rump, for example.

4. Sources of fat

Extra virgin olive oil, nuts and avocado are good examples of sources of healthy, unsaturated fats recommended for a low carb diet.

These foods help prevent cardiovascular diseases, contribute to increasing good cholesterol and lowering bad cholesterol and reducing the risk of heart attack or atherosclerosis.

Foods that should be avoided

1. Fat proteins

Sausages rich in sodium, bacon, meat with skin, such as drumsticks, visible fat, such as cuts such as termite and picanha; There are some types of proteins that should be avoided by those who go low carb. They are sources of saturated fat and should not exceed 10% of the daily calories of a healthy diet.

2. Sources of saturated fats

As we have already said, saturated fat is present in fatty meats and sausages, but it can also be found in abundance in other types of processed foods.

Biscuits, even savory ones; snacks and all types of food made from palm oil or hydrogenated fat are on this list, in addition to being a type of trans fat.

For those who don’t know, these sources of fat increase the risk of overweight, obesity and the development of chronic diseases, such as cardiovascular diseases.

Beware of deceiving foods!

Whole-grain pasta, such as industrialized bread and pasta, are good examples of foods that seem healthy, but can sabotage a low-carb diet.

Despite containing more fiber, this type of food is not low carb, as are cereals such as brown rice, chickpeas, beans, lentils and so on.

They have a low glycemic index, provide slower digestion, but are very rich in carbohydrates and, therefore, should be consumed in moderation. So, don’t be fooled!
